Team — the typo-squatting package scanner is now fully cut over from the old Larkspur pipeline to Sentrypod. All registry feeds were re-pointed yesterday evening, the backlog of unscanned packages was cleared overnight, and alert routing now goes to the security channel rather than the legacy mailing list. Scan latency dropped noticeably. The old Larkspur jobs have been disabled but not deleted; we'll remove them after two quiet weeks. For reference, the scanner now runs with the following production settings.

deployment values, yadug-bawif:
[framir]
team = pelox
access_code = ac_a38ab2
owner = tamion.julael
host = framir.tolvaqlabs.test
port = 11211
peer = tammir.zemvargrid.local
salt = 2215ef03
pin = 1541

## Session Handling for Health Checks

The Corvel gateway sits behind the Lanternside load balancer, which probes /healthz every ten seconds. Health-check requests are stateless by design: they bypass the session store entirely so that probe traffic never inflates session counts or evicts real user sessions. New team members should note that the deep-check endpoint, /healthz/deep, does verify session-store connectivity and therefore requires authentication. When probing it manually, supply the token below.

bearer token for tajep-kajef: eyJhbGciOiJIUzI1NiIsInR5cCI6IkpXVCJ9.eyJzdWIiOiIoOsZ23In0.CsygO0hs

Handover: Fixture Foundry maintenance. Plugin authors extend the factory registry via the `foundry.plugins` entry point; each plugin must declare its schema version or registration fails silently in 2.x (fixed in 3.0). The seed corpus regenerates nightly, so don't commit generated fixtures. Outstanding item: the Orvaine adapter still uses the deprecated trait API. When running the generator locally, plugins are resolved using the following configuration values.

config for kafof-bawef:
holath:
  log_level: debug
  metrics_host: metrics.holath.qorvelsys.internal
  pin: 2191
  pool_size: 32